About the role
This position is responsible for building mechanical products in accordance with customer supplied assembly documentation and Vander-Bend Manufacturing standards.
Responsibilities
- Incorporates all of the responsibilities required of an Mechanical Assembler 1, plus the following
- Assembles the most complex Mechanical assemblies independently or under limited supervision
- Performs low to moderate level mechanical product testing using established methods and fixtures
- Reads, understands, interprets, and accurately follows complex written assembly instructions without assistance
- Provides technical assistance to less skilled assemblers
- Participates in department meetings, identifies barriers to efficient operations, and need for additional or improved tools, fixtures, or methods, and communicates improvement ideas to area lead or supervisor
Requirements
- 2+ years of previous assembly work, at least one year of which must be in Mechanical products which are similar to those manufactured by Vander-Bend
- Ability to read, write and perform basic arithmetic problems
- Must understand complex written and verbal instructions
- Mush read and interpret blueprints and or schematics
- Must use basic hand, electric, and pneumatic tools used in performing specific operator requirements
Physical Requirements
- Medium work: Exerting up to 50 pounds of force occasionally, and/or up to 20 pounds of force frequently, and/or up to 10 pounds of force constantly to move objects.
- Heavy work: Exerting up to 100 pounds of force occasionally, and/or up to 50 pounds of force frequently, and/or up to 20 pounds of force constantly to move objects.
